What I'm trying to move is an original, first edition Vintage Club 50 watt head. This is the one that was designed by Obeid Khan, the current mastermind behind Reason Amps. 50 watts out of four EL-84's. Fendery cleans and some great, smooth OD when you wind the clean channel way up. Good medium-gain Marshally-Voxy tones out of the drive channel. FX loop, separate reverb controls for each channel.
